commented on @cold blood 's other week, wish mine would hurry up from its dark brown tiny phase but refuses to molt, only eats every 3 times I try to feed, argh. but if yours is an 1" and looks like that then i'll be happy sooner than later... so how fast is this one growing?
 
When they start getting colors, like the one here, they become better eaters and growth rates actually pick up a bit. Juvies and adults are night and day different from slings with regards to feeding response.
